Real-world photo gallery gives us an idea how the iPhone Xs and iPhone Xs Max will perform

When it comes to smartphones, it isn't so much about how powerful it is anymore, but how well it can take pictures and videos. Over the years, iPhones have offered an experience that is pretty reliable when it comes to quality. So it only makes sense that the cameras found in its new devices would also be quite respectable. While the iPhone Xs and iPhone Xs Max won't make it into consumers hands until the end of the week, it looks like a lucky few are already out there experimenting with Apple's latest.

Travel photographer Austin Mann is one such person, making use of the new phone, but also posting the results for all to see. It's always hard to judge a picture when you don't know the conditions it was taken in, but judging from what has been uploaded, things look good and it should at least give you a small idea on how images from the new phones will look like.

Luckily, if you want to check out the full resolution images yourself and pixel peep, you can download the entire photo set from Mann's Flickr.
